Donald Bliss was fired last Wednesday for the inappropriate use of his department cell phone and for alleged ethics violations surrounding his part time involvement in the alarm industry.

Chief Joyce says he is confident a pending Civil Service Commission review of the matter will reveal the charges are political retribution and without merit.

In a press release issued today, Joyce writes:

Lt. Bliss began his career as a seasonal officer in 1985, and was appointed full time in 1987. In 1993 he was promoted to Sergeant and later served as head of the Detective Division from 1997 to 2003. In this capacity, he was responsible for the investigation of all major cases, including homicides, sexual assaults, court prosecutions and evidence/property preservation. He was promoted to Lieutenant in 2003 and has served as the Assistant Patrol Division Commander responsible for both evening shifts. He has held numerous assignments including: the Truck Team; Tactical Team; Field Training Officer; Firearms Instructor; MACE Team; Coastal Task Force Supervisor; Citizens Academy Instructor; and member of the Honor Guard.

Donald has served with distinction and honor for 24 years, has no previous discipline in his file, and has received over 22 commendations. He was responsible for creating the Neighborhood Action Team (NAT) that helped resolve the numerous problems identified in Onset Village over the last 2 years. In concert with these efforts, he developed the Landlord Assistant Program (LAP) where he personally maintained contact with landlords and realtors in an effort to identify criminal elements. The Lieutenant also developed the plans for Onset’s Community Safety Partnership and obtained the operating grant money.
